Checking Electric Compatibility



To make sure a successful heat pump installation, it's essential to inspect the electric compatibility of your assigned setup location. Begin by ensuring that your electrical panel has the capability to sustain the brand-new heat pump. https://www.sarasotamagazine.com/news-and-profiles/2020/08/careeredge-offers-tuition-free-hvac-installation-and-maintenance-fast-track-training if there are enough readily available breaker and adequate amperage to manage the additional load. If required, talk to a certified electrical contractor to analyze and upgrade your electrical system.



Next off, verify if the voltage demands of the heat pump match your home's electric supply. Most heat pumps operate on standard household voltage, yet it's important to confirm this to stop any electrical concerns throughout setup. Additionally, make certain that the wiring in your home is in good condition and satisfies the specs laid out by the heatpump supplier.

Finally, take into consideration the place of the nearby source of power to the outside unit of the heat pump. It ought to be within reach for simple link without the need for extensive electrical wiring. By addressing these electrical compatibility factors beforehand, you can make sure a smooth and successful heat pump setup process.
